2 / 9 page BH□□RB1WGUT series Technical Note 2/8 www.rohm.com 2011.01 - Rev.C © 2011 ROHM Co., Ltd. All rights reserved. ● Absolute maximum ratings Parameter Symbol Ratings Unit Applied supply voltage VMAX -0.3 to +6.5 V Power dissipation Pd 530 *1 mW Operating temperature range Topr -40 to +85 °C Storage temperature range Tstg -55 to +125 °C *1: Reduce by 5.3 mW/ C over 25C, when mounted on a glass epoxy PCB (7 mm 7 mm 0.8 mm). ● Recommended operating ranges (not to exceed Pd) Parameter Symbol Ratings Unit Power supply voltage VIN 2.5 to 5.5 V Output current IOUT 0 to 150 mA ● Recommended operating conditions Parameter Symbol Ratings Unit Conditions Min. Typ. Max. Input capacitor CIN 0.7 *2 1.0 — µF The use of ceramic capacitors is recommended. Output capacitor CO 0.7 *2 1.0 — µF The use of ceramic capacitors is recommended. *2: Make sure that the output capacitor value is not kept lower than this specified level across a variety of temperature, DC bias characteristic. And also make sure that the capacitor value cannot change as time progresses. ● Electrical characteristics (Unless otherwise specified, Ta = 25°C, VIN = VOUT + 1.0 V *5, STBY = 1.5 V, CIN = 1 µF, CO = 1 µF) Parameter Symbol Limits Unit Conditions Min. Typ. Max. Output voltage 1 VOUT1 VOUT 0.99 VOUT VOUT 1.01 V IOUT = 1 mA, Ta = 25°C, BH25RB1WGUT or higher VOUT - 25 mV VOUT + 25 mV IOUT = 1mA, Ta = 25°C, BH15, 18RB1WGUT Output voltage 2 VOUT2 VOUT 0.97 VOUT VOUT 1.03 V IOUT = 1 mA Ta = -40°C to 85°C *3 Circuit current IGND — 34 72 µA IOUT = 0 mA Ta = -40°C to 85°C *3 Circuit current (STBY) ICCST — — 1.0 µA STBY = 0 V Ripple rejection ratio RR — 63 — dB VRR = -20 dBV, fRR = 1 kHz, IOUT = 10 mA Dropout voltage VSAT — 100 150 mV VIN = 0.98 VOUT, IOUT = 100 mA (Excluding BH15, 18RB1WGUT) Line regulation VDLI — 2 20 mV IOUT = 10 mA VIN = VOUT + 0.5 V to 5.5 V *4 Load regulation VDLO — 2 30 mV IOUT = 1 mA to 100 mA Overcurrent protection limit current ILMAX — 300 — mA VO = VOUT 0.98 Short current ISHORT — 40 — mA VO = 0 V STBY pin current ISTBY 0.5 1.3 3.6 µA Ta = -40°C to 85°C *3 STBY control voltage ON VSTBH 1.2 — VIN V Ta = -40°C to 85°C *3 OFF VSTBL -0.2 — 0.2 V Ta = -40°C to 85°C *3 * This IC is not designed to be radiation-resistant. *3: These specifications are guaranteed by design. *4: For BH15, 18RB1WGUT, VIN = 3.0 V to 5.5 V. *5: For BH15, 18RB1WGUT, VIN = 3.5 V. |
